In 2025, the gaming community has been buzzing with excitement over the unearthing of a long-lost project that ties directly into the dystopian universe of George Orwell's 1984. A true gem from the past, the alpha demo of Big Brother, a game adaptation of Orwell's iconic novel, was recently discovered and shared online. This project, which acts as a chronological continuation of Orwell's vision, offers fans a rare glimpse into an ambitious exploration of the novel's themes through interactive storytelling.
Big Brother was first showcased at E3 1998, sparking curiosity and excitement with its bold concept. Sadly, the project was canceled in 1999, leaving many to speculate on what might have been. Fast forward 27 years, and in March 2025, the alpha build of the game surfaced online, thanks to a user named ShedTroll. This unexpected release not only reignited interest in the title but also highlighted its groundbreaking design approach.
Set in Orwell's haunting world, Big Brother's storyline follows Eric Blair, a nod to Orwell's real name, as he embarks on a mission to rescue his fiancée from the clutches of the Thought Police. The game ingeniously combined puzzle-solving elements similar to those found in Riven with the high-octane action mechanics inspired by Quake. This unique mix was intended to challenge players intellectually and physically while immersing them in a terrifying portrayal of a society under constant surveillance.
Though Big Brother never made it to a full release, its rediscovery provides a fascinating window into late-'90s game development and the innovative ways developers attempted to bring literary classics to life through interactive media. For enthusiasts of dystopian literature and retro gaming, this discovery is a treasure trove waiting to be explored.
